Fiber optic cable channel 300 typically refers to either a 300mm-wide raceway for cable protection or a 300-meter fiber optic cable assembly for network deployment.300mm Fiber Optic Channels / Raceways

A 300mm fiber optic channel is a straight or curved raceway designed to route, protect, and manage fiber optic cables in data centers, telecom rooms, and other critical environments. These channels are often made from flame-retardant, halogen-free materials (PC+ABS-FR UL 94V-0) and feature tool-free installation for quick placement or removal of covers, ensuring cables are shielded from physical damage and contaminants . Key features include:

  • Modular design for easy expansion and capacity management
  • Bend radius protection (typically ≥50mm) to prevent fiber stress
  • Compatibility with straight and curved fittings for complex routing
  • Color options (e.g., yellow RAL 1018, black RAL 9005) for identification
  • Applications: Central Offices, Head-ends, Remote Offices, Data Centers, and Wiring Closets
300-Meter Fiber Optic Cable Assemblies

A 300m fiber optic cable assembly is a pre-terminated or bulk cable used for long-distance network connections. These cables can be single-mode or multi-mode, with specifications such as:

  • Six-strand single-mode (G.657.A2)
  • Outer diameter: ~6.0 mm, fiber strand diameter: 0.25 mm
  • Outdoor-rated jacket with ripcord, weatherproof tape, and Kevlar for tensile strength
  • Insertion loss: ≤0.5 dB/km at 1310 nm and 1550 nm These assemblies are suitable for indoor and outdoor deployments, including backbone connections, campus networks, and telecom infrastructure .
Choosing Between Channel and Cable
  • 300mm channel: Focuses on cable management and protection, ideal for structured cabling in buildings.
  • 300m cable: Focuses on signal transmission over distance, ideal for connecting network equipment or extending fiber runs. By combining 300mm channels with 300m fiber cables, network engineers can ensure both efficient routing and reliable signal transmission, meeting international standards for safety, durability, and performance .
